   Film shows underwater workings of trawling nets. Fishing boat with net being pulled in. Catch of fish. Study of how nets behave carried out in seas off Malta on the Sir Lancelot. Diver with underwater camera. Action of different nets, described in detail. Ministry of Agriculture, Fisheries and Food Made by the Fisheries Laboratory, Lowestoft Produced by Basic Films Scientific Supervisor A R Margetts Underwater photography J H Hodges Frogman J D Graham Editor J B Napier-Bell
